Job Description

Job Summary: You will observe all areas Casino operations using video and audio technologies, perform multiple reviews for Tribal Police and Casino Departments along with compiling accurate reports on incidents occurring on Casino property. You will report to the Surveillance Shift Manager or Lead.

Full-Time

Pay Rate: $19.30

Days and Shift to be determined

Primary Tasks:

  • You will observe all areas of operations in the casino using digital video surveillance (CCTV) equipment.

  • You will conduct routine observations focused on funds-handling operational areas to determine if breaks in established casino procedures have occurred.

  • You will perform multiple casino department video reviews to determine breaks in procedure along with documenting any found irregularities or deviations of established processes. Document suspicious activity by using PC applications such as Microsoft Word or CIP reporting software.

  • You will review video as requested by Casino Management, Safety, Security, Tribal Police, and provides incident documentation. May also assist Security or Tribal Police with internal investigations relating to sensitive security issues.

  • You will compile different reports focusing on accuracy, also ensuring all paperwork is error free and completed promptly.

  • You will remain current on and have comprehensive knowledge of surveillance and casino department MICS, TICS, and SICS and department Procedures and protects the confidential nature of casino department observations, recorded video and surveillance activities.

  • You will ensure that videos are references and archived for potential future use.

  • If needed, will record video incidents to CD's/DVD's and prepare incident documentation for distribution to multiple approved Choctaw Nation Departments.

  • May testify in court.

  • Other responsibilities as may be assigned.

About the Choctaw Nation

The Choctaw Nation is the third-largest Indian nation in the United States, with over 200,000 tribal members and more than 11,000 employees. The first tribe over the Trail of Tears, historic boundaries are in the southeast corner of Oklahoma. The Choctaw Nation's vision, "Living out the Chahta Spirit of faith, family and culture," is evident as it continues to focus on providing opportunities for growth and prosperity.
